Isolation and partial characterization of a kallikrein from mouse submaxillary glands.

A simple procedure to obtain relatively large amounts of purified kallikrein from male mouse submaxillary gland is described. Some chemical and biological properties of this kallikrein have been investigated. The enzyme has a m.w. of 32,000 and shows strong BAEE-esterase activity, as well as kininogenase activity. It is partially inhibited by Aprotinin.
